Hamada vs Ngaumu Forest Climate & Distance Between

New Zealand flag
  • The distance between Hamada, Japan and Ngaumu Forest, New Zealand is approximately 9,554 km or 5,937 mi.
  • To reach Hamada in this distance one would set out from Ngaumu Forest bearing 325.3°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Hamada bearing 328.4° or NNW .
  • Hamada has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Ngaumu Forest has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
  • Hamada is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ome whereas Ngaumu Forest is in or near the warm temperate thorn steppe biome.
  • The annual mean temperature is 3.5 °C (6.3°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 10.8 °C (19.4°F) more in Hamada. The continentality subtype is semicontinental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 576.9 mm (22.7 in) more which is equivalent to 576.9 l/m² (14.16 US gal/ft²) or 5,769,000 l/ha (616,744 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/2 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 6.8° higher in Hamada than in Ngaumu Forest.
